Description

Stromanthe triostar, also known as Stromanthe sanguinea 'Triostar' or simply Triostar, is a popular tropical plant valued for its stunning foliage. It belongs to the Marantaceae family and is native to rainforests in Brazil. A must have plant for any houseplant lover.

Native to: Brazil

Growth Pattern: Upright

Watering: Water when the top 3cm of the substrate is dry. Avoid overwatering, as this can lead to root rot.

Light: Thrives in medium to bright indirect light. Avoid low-light conditions to prevent leggy growth and maintain vibrant foliage.

Humidity: Adaptable to various humidity levels, making it suitable for different environments.

Get to know me

About Stromanthe sanguinea 'Triostar'

Stromanthe sanguinea 'Triostar' is a houseplant that takes a little effort. It needs bright indirect light, watering often enough to keep the compost evenly moist, high humidity and a minimum temperature of 15°C. It is listed as non-toxic to cats and dogs.

Feeding

Feed monthly with a balanced fertiliser from spring to autumn, and let it rest over winter.

Toxicity

Listed as non-toxic to cats and dogs. Plants still are not food, so a determined chewer may get an upset stomach.

What should I do when my plant arrives?
First things first, unbox it as soon as you can. Plants don't love being in dark boxes any more than you would, and the sooner yours is out and breathing, the better.

Remove all the packaging carefully, give the soil a check with your finger, and water lightly if it feels dry. Then find it a spot with appropriate light, but avoid putting it straight into harsh direct sun or next to a radiator. Think of it like arriving somewhere new after a long journey: it needs a moment to adjust.

It's completely normal for your plant to look a little tired or droopy after transit. This is called transit stress, and most plants bounce back within a week or two. You might see a yellow leaf or some drooping, don't panic, and resist the urge to overwater or start repotting straight away.

Our advice for the first couple of weeks: leave it in its nursery pot, water it only when the top layer of soil feels dry, and let it acclimatise to your home's light, temperature, and humidity. Once it's settled in and showing signs of new growth, you can think about repotting or moving it to its permanent spot.
